Creation of Humphreys County Water Authority

⚠️
PROPOSED LEGISLATIONThis bill has been introduced but has NOT been signed into law. Legislative proposals may be amended, passed, or fail to advance. This is not current law.

This proposed bill would create the Humphreys County Water Authority if approved locally. Before this change, there was no specific water authority for Humphreys County. The creation of this new entity would affect residents and businesses within Humphreys County who rely on water services. If enacted, it would provide a structured approach to managing water resources in the county. However, local approval is required before the authority can be established.
